Hello folks,

I just moved here from a string of locations both north and east from here, and keep hearing that tinting my windows is the only way to keep my car from cooking me.

So does anyone know of a good place to tint? Anywhere NOT to go? I don't want blisters in my tints!

Anywhere super cost effective? I have a 99 Forester, with a total of 7 windows to tint.. ouch..

I just had my wife's 03 Forrester done by Albuquerque Auto Glass, on 4th, just North of Candelaria. it was around $200 (I think cash price was a small break). They did a very good job. Tell 'em the guy with the White Subaru Wagon sent you, maybe I'll get a deal when i finally bring my Tacoma in there...

Be careful if you plan on going to other states-- I think NM can be darker than other places, but if you get pulled over in California, they can peel 'em while you watch in horror...

Or at least enforcement here is VERY lax... I think I asked to go darker (esp. in the back where my dog and her tongue hangs out and they were "cool" with it.

I think NM requires at least 20% of light in. Here's a link to TintLaws. My current vehicle has tint on the back and rear sides and it's great.
